Not to mention state taxes and a host of other taxes on practically everything including the air you breath. ---And whenever they raise taxes on the rich somehow it always comes down to the middle class as well. ---What no one seems to understand is that there is a point of "diminishing returns." That is, by raising certain taxes you get LESS money. That happened on the luxury tax they passed some years back on boats. Sales went down so low that the industry almost went bankrupt and far less tax was collected. They quickly rescinded the tax.
